My Philosophy
I believe that every student learns differently. For some, many repetitions are required before the skill is mastered. For others, understanding is all that is needed. Some students understand concepts immediately, and some need some time to process. Some students learn from explanation, and some learn by doing. I love getting to know my students well enough that I can ascertain what works best for them, what motivates them, and what will help them the most. I strive to help students learn concepts for good, not just for the assignment or test. With that comes addressing the underlying issues, making sure a student understands the basics solidly before they can understand advanced material.
